Genres

What is popular?

- SLG (Strategy)

- RPG (ARPG)

- Battlers (DOTA Legend was huge!)

- Shooting games (to some extent)

Genre landscape is actually quite different from what we used to see in the West.

Hardcore and midcore games are dominant, while casual titles are declining.

Local IPs

Using local Intellectual properties reduces

marketing costs quite a bit.

- Novels

- TV Shows and movies

- Manga

- Classic literature

- Bonus – celebrities!
